Abstract
Proposals to construct multiple offshore liquefied natural gas terminals (LNG) in the United States that planned to use<br>seawater as a heat source for vaporization of LNG have prompted assessments of the potential for entrainment of marine<br>organisms in seawater intakes to impact fisheries. The publication of multiple impact assessments for facilities in the same<br>region facilitated a critical review of the techniques currently in use and led to research on improvements in assessment<br>methodology.
